believe it or not i just got a call from xtreme (moving to a new workshop so they are doing long hours) as they played musical chairs with the car they noticed the rear wheels locked up. after trying to figure out what was wrong, the pulled the gearbox out and noticed that the input shaft was bent!

well answers that question as to how strong the t-56 is. lucky for me a that a company called liberty gears from the usa does a 26 spline input shaft for these things, only problem is that my ap racing twin plate nizpro clutch and flywheel wont fit so i will need to go for a triple plate carbon clutch!

will it ever end?

briefly i considered what ppg have to offer, but a flatshifting dogbox with all that power scares me a little!
